      <description>&lt;p&gt;OTel Night Amsterdam v2026.05 is happening on &lt;strong&gt;May 20th&lt;/strong&gt; at ING Cedar, Amsterdam — and the lineup is genuinely exciting.&lt;/p&gt;

&lt;p&gt;&lt;strong&gt;Disclosure:&lt;/strong&gt; I'm one of the organizers. Free CNCF community event, no vendor sponsorship, no commercial interest.&lt;/p&gt;

&lt;h2&gt;
  
  
  What's happening
&lt;/h2&gt;

&lt;p&gt;Engineers from two of the Netherlands' largest companies are coming to share real OpenTelemetry war stories:&lt;/p&gt;

&lt;p&gt;&lt;strong&gt;Talk 1:&lt;/strong&gt; Giuseppe d'Alessio &amp;amp; Vincent Free (ING) — OpenTelemetry at scale in one of Europe's largest banks&lt;/p&gt;

&lt;p&gt;&lt;strong&gt;Talk 2:&lt;/strong&gt; Bernardo Garcia &amp;amp; Ivan Merrill (Albert Heijn) — OTel in production (TBC)&lt;/p&gt;

&lt;p&gt;No vendor pitches. No slides-only fluff. Practitioners talking to practitioners — the edge cases, the instrumentation choices they'd redo, and the patterns that actually scaled.&lt;/p&gt;
